Read on for the full tutorial (<em>note: instructions are for FreeNAS 9.2.0 or later<\/em>).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<!--more-->\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Here is what you\u2019ll need<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>\u2022 An old computer with a 64 bit AMD or Intel processor (required)<br>\u2022 At least one hard drive in the computer containing no important data (required)<br>\u2022 2GB or larger thumb drive (4GB recommended)<br>\u2022 At least 4GB of ram (highly recommended)<br>\u2022 CAT5 cable (required)<br>\u2022 Writable CD or DVD, CD or DVD burner, and CD or DVD drive (optional)<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Installation and Initial Setup<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>1.<\/strong> Go to <a href=\"http:\/\/FreeNAS.org\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">FreeNAS.org<\/a> and get the latest version of FreeNAS in 64-bit.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>2.<\/strong> If you have a writable CD or DVD and a CD or DVD burner as well as a CD or DVD drive that can be used with the system on which you plan to install FreeNAS, you may download the CD Installer (.iso file), burn it to disk, and use these <a href=\"http:\/\/doc.freenas.org\/index.php\/Installing_from_CDROM\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">instructions to install FreeNAS<\/a><\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Install2a.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Install2a.png\" alt=\"Install2a\" class=\"wp-image-3554\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Alternatively, use the .img.xz file from the \u201cLegacy and 32-bit Downloads\u201d tab with these instructions: http:\/\/doc.freenas.org\/index.php\/Burning_an_IMG_File<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>3.<\/strong> Once you have the thumb drive created, connect the computer to your router (only an ethernet connection will work, as FreeNAS does not support wireless connections). Boot from the USB drive. Once it boots, it will give you an IP address from which to log in to the FreeNAS web UI.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Initial1b.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Initial1b.png\" alt=\"Initial1b\" class=\"wp-image-3555\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>4.<\/strong> Go to that address from a computer on the same LAN as the FreeNAS box and you will see the FreeNAS login page, which will prompt you to make a password. Note that this password will be the root password for the entire FreeNAS install, so choose carefully!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Webgui1e.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/Webgui1e.png\" alt=\"Webgui1e\" class=\"wp-image-3556\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Volume, Datasets, and Permissions<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>5.<\/strong> Now that you\u2019re in the FreeNAS Web UI, you\u2019ll need to create a user and group for BitTorrent Sync. In the left side menu, click the \u201cAccount\u201d dropdown, and then \u201cUsers\u201d. Choose \u201cAdd New User\u201d. Create a new user named \u201cbtsync&#8221;, with the UID \u2018817\u2019. This is critical later: make absolutely certain the UID matches. Leave \u201cCreate a new primary group for this user\u201d checked. Fill something into the Full Name field and choose a password, then click \u201cOK\u201d to create the user.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><em>For reference, see http:\/\/doc.freenas.org\/index.php\/Users.<\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"http:\/\/bittorrent.com\/sync\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/BTSyncUserCreation.png\" alt=\"BTSyncUserCreation\" class=\"wp-image-3557\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>6.<\/strong> Next, click on the \u201cVolumes\u201d button. You\u2019ll be on the Volumes tab. Click \u201cZFS Volume Manager\u201d to bring up the dialog to create a new volume. If you don\u2019t want to worry about the details, just name the volume, click the \u201c+\u201d button next to your disks to add them to the setup (it will make a recommended RAID setup based on the drives you add). If you prefer a specific RAID setup, read the <a href=\"http:\/\/doc.freenas.org\/9.3\/freenas_storage.html\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">ZFS Volume Manager Documentation<\/a>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>7.<\/strong> Select the volume you just made. The fourth button from the left at the bottom of the window is the \u201cCreate Dataset\u201d button. Click that to bring up the new dataset dialog. Create a dataset called \u201cJails\u201d and another dataset called \u201cFiles\u201d (or something else that lets you know this is the folder you\u2019ll be syncing).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>8.<\/strong> Click on the \u201cFiles\u201d dataset and click \u201cChange Permissions\u201d, the first button on the left at the bottom of the window. This will bring up a permissions dialog. Type in \u201cbtsync\u201d for both user and group. Give both user and group read and write permissions. This is important to make sure that BTSync can write to the folder later.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/FilesDatasetPermissions.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/FilesDatasetPermissions.png\" alt=\"FilesDatasetPermissions\" class=\"wp-image-3558\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Jails and the Plugin<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>9.<\/strong> Now, click the \u201cJails\u201d dropdown in the left-side menu and select \u201cConfiguration\u201d. Under \u201cJail Root\u201d, click browse and click through the folders until you can select the dataset you created called \u201cJails\u201d. Save the settings.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/JailsConfigurationUI.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/JailsConfigurationUI.png\" alt=\"JailsConfigurationUI\" class=\"wp-image-3559\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>10.<\/strong> Click the \u201cPlugins\u201d button at the top of the window. This will bring up a list of available plugins. Click on \u201cbtsync\u201d and then click on \u201cInstall\u201d at the bottom of the window. A progress bar will appear showing the progress of the plugin download, which will take a while depending on your internet connection. Once the downloads and installation complete, go to the \u201cInstalled\u201d tab and turn on the BTSync service.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>11.<\/strong> Return to the \u201cJails\u201d tab. Click on the new jail, which will be called something like \u201cbtsync_1\u201d. At the bottom of the window, click the second button from the left, \u201cAdd Storage\u201d. For \u201cSource\u201d, click through the dropdowns and select the second dataset you made, \u201cFiles\u201d. For \u201cDestination\u201d, you can either type in a custom path such as \u201c\/btsync\u201d, or choose an existing empty folder, such as \u201c\/media\u201d. Click OK to save the mount point.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/AddStorageDialog.png\" data-rel=\"lightbox-gallery-tKOkDbKI\" data-rl_title=\"\" data-rl_caption=\"\" title=\"\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.resilio.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/02\/AddStorageDialog.png\" alt=\"AddStorageDialog\" class=\"wp-image-3560\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Using Resilio Sync<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>12.<\/strong> You\u2019re almost done! In the left side menu, click the \u201cPlugins\u201d dropdown. Click the \u201cBTSync\u201d button. The settings for BTSync will appear. You shouldn\u2019t need to modify any of these settings, so just click the link under \u201chere\u201d to be taken to the BTSync Web UI. When you go to add a folder, make sure it\u2019s the one you selected as the \u201cDestination\u201d when \u201cadding storage\u201d earlier. You can add more folders by repeating the process with making a dataset, changing the user and group permissions, and adding storage to the btsync jail.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Conclusion<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>You now have BitTorrent Sync working in FreeNAS.
